What is the red area under my puppy’s eye? I’m about to get this dog but its eye looks off

The red under the eye is tear staining, often from oily, salty food causing excess tears that oxidize, or congenital blocked tear ducts. Adjust to low-fat, low-salt food, clean the eyes often, and use care eye drops like honeysuckle drops to reduce stains and fight bacteria.

How to choose a Corgi?

When picking a Corgi puppy, first check its build: purebred Corgis should not have overly long legs but should have sturdy bones, round paws and a balanced body. Next observe its mental state and coat; a purebred has smooth, dense fur in two or three colors. Finally check the facial features: oval eyes matching coat color, large round triangular ears and a black nose.

A one-month-old puppy has one eye bigger than the other and that eye keeps discharging; I don’t know why.

A puppy's tearing can come from ingrown lashes, irritants, blocked tear ducts, heat or eye infection. First check for foreign objects or irritating smells and flush with saline, then apply eye drops.
